Q: What age group do you teach?

A: My classes are perfect for young learners, typically ages 7 to 12, who are eager to take their first steps into the world of coding.

Q: How does Scratch prepare my child for the future?

A: Scratch not only introduces basic programming concepts but also develops logical reasoning and design skills. It's a wonderful foundation for any child interested in technology, gaming, or computer sciences.

Q: What is the structure of your Scratch coding class?

A: Each class is designed to maximize learning while having fun. I break down the session into interactive lessons, hands-on coding time, and games that reinforce the day's concepts.
